Tnx for replies,

this is the source I followed: http://www.maxcheaters.com/topic/201050-lsbogsscrolls-stackable-l2jfrozen-fully-working/

Everything else works like a charm: stacking, droping stack,selling, enchanting proces/.destroyItem - all is fine, just the enchant "+" number is one step behind.

With the first enchant sysmsg says

"Your Arcana Mace has been successfully enchanted" ,invtory has it +1, when I go for +2, sysmsg:

"Your +1 Arcana Mace has been successfully enchanted", inventory has +2, going for+3:

"Your +2 Arcana Mace has been successfully enchaned".  Well if you look it that way -the previous +2 IS successfully enchanted...

//and damn I can't rememmber the sysmsg, it's been a while I played, but isn't it suppose to say something like "Your (weapon) has been successfully enchanted to + <-------..." ?

Could it be the wrong system msg used?
